Understanding Proxies
Proxies are intermediary hosts that act as gateways between individuals and the internet. When you connect to a proxy, your requests are sent to the intermediary server initially, which then forwards them to the desired site. This configuration helps to conceal your true IP address and can be used for various reasons including surfing anonymously, accessing restricted material, or extracting data from websites.

There are different types of proxy servers, each serving specific needs. HTTP proxies are commonly used for web traffic, while Socket Secure proxies provide more versatility by managing all types of traffic including TCP and User Datagram Protocol. Additionally, proxy servers can be classified into private and public categories. Dedicated proxy servers are dedicated to a single individual, offering better performance and privacy, whereas public proxies are shared among multiple individuals and may offer less reliability and safety.
Using proxy servers is essential for activities like internet scraping, where automated tools gather data from websites. A dependable proxy setup allows you to overcome geographical barriers, avoid IP blockages, and maintain privacy during your scraping activities. Grasping the types and functions of proxy servers will empower you to choose the appropriate configuration for your particular needs.
Choosing the Right Proxy Type
When selecting an appropriate kind of proxy for your requirements, it's crucial to understand the differences among HTTP, SOCKS4, and SOCKS5 proxies. HTTP are primarily used (are mainly) used to handle web traffic while which are suitable to perform browsing & basic jobs. They work effectively when you don't need advanced features. On another side, SOCKS proxies proxies give more flexibility & can handle any type of traffic, including P2P connections as well as programs that require more than just HTTP protocols.
SOCKS 4 are offer basic abilities but are quicker compared to SOCKS 5 proxies. Nonetheless, SOCKS5 offers extra capabilities, including improved authentication methods as well as compatibility with the latest internet protocol version. This renders SOCKS5 a superior choice in tasks that necessitate a higher level of safety and capabilities, especially for sensitive data and complex applications. Grasping these distinctions helps you make a better educated choice based on your particular requirements.
Alongside the type of proxy, take into account its source of your proxy types. Dedicated proxy servers typically provide superior speed and improved security, making them perfect for serious web scraping & automation tasks. On the other hand, free proxy servers might be available for free but can often result in problems like reduced performance along with unreliable service. Balancing needs of speed, anonymity, & reliability will guide you to selecting your appropriate proxy type to use in your projects.
